我做了文本区域,我希望当我的文本超出文本区域的宽度然后而不是创建滚动条它应该只是增加文本区域的宽度我怎么能这样做这里是HTML代码和CSS我正在申请这个请建议我一些事情。我想让这个文本区像facebook评论框一样工作?
<style>
.textarticle
{
box-shadow: inset 0 0 10px rgba(0, 0, 0, 0.18);
width:600px;
max-width:600px;
min-height: 50px;
max-height: 140px;
border:1px solid E7DBDB;
border-radius:5px;
overflow:none;
}
</style>
<html>
<textarea class="textarticle" name="textarticl" placeholder="Enter Article">
</html>
答案 0 :(得分:1)
@JoshCrozier是对的,你想要overflow:hidden
。要使textarea自动扩展高度,您需要一些JQuery插件的帮助。一个有用的是杰克摩尔的autosize.js。
只需致电$('textarea').autosize();
,您就可以了。
这是展示它的jsFiddle。
答案 1 :(得分:0)
添加溢出:自动
textarea {overflow:auto; }